Barium
Part of speech: noun
Pronunciation: /ˈbɛəɹɪəm/
Definitions
- A chemical element belonging to the alkaline earth metals, often used in medical imaging and industrial applications
- A soft silvery-white metallic element with the atomic number 56, utilized in various compounds for diverse uses
- A highly reactive metal that readily combines with other elements, found mainly in minerals and used to enhance certain materials
Etymology: The term "barium" has its roots in the Greek word "barys," meaning "heavy." This etymological origin is fitting, as barium is a chemical element characterized by its significant density. The name was introduced to the scientific community in the early 19th century, when the element was isolated from its mineral compounds. The first recorded use of the term in English dates back to 1808 when English chemist Sir Humphry Davy identified and named the element after its heavy salts, showcasing its distinctive properties.
